SES light won't go away!

I just got my car back together for the summer. When I turn the key to the on position my SES light comes on and stays lit and the primary fan comes on.

I tried a code scan, the SES light just stay lit

I did a 730 conversion last summer and drove it for a few months on SD.
This is what I have tried to fix it:
1) Tried new different memcal
2) Reprogram chip like 3 times
3) Tried different 730 ECU I know is good b/c it works on another car.

I know a bad chip or memcal or the chip in backwards will cause the SES light to stay on but what else will cause this?

My Setup: 89 IROC converted to 730, using Craig Moates memcal adapter, and PP2

Ok, so now you have the code 12 engine off key on? Will it start? And yes, in Craig's adaptor the notch on the chip faces AWAY from the zif handle and towards the edge of the ECM.
Make sure the adaptor is fully seated in the ECM too. also, if you have another chip you may want to try it, if not see about getting one, might have a bad chip.

Finally fixed it all. I was having a starting problem which was my starter so I couldn't fully test the chip, fixed that. I fixed the limp home problem. The 2 chips I tried were bad. I burned a new one and it works great.

So anyone who can’t get the thing out of limp home mode, keep trying new chips…
